Secure computing is crucial in today's digital world. It ensures the protection of data and systems from unauthorized access and cyber threats. Here are some key aspects of secure computing:

  • Encryption: Encrypting data ensures that it can only be accessed by those with the correct decryption key.
  • Firewalls: Firewalls act as a barrier between a trusted internal network and an untrusted external network, controlling incoming and outgoing traffic.
  • Antivirus Software: Antivirus software helps protect against malware and other malicious software.
  • Regular Updates: Keeping software and systems up-to-date with the latest security patches is essential.
